In the Fantastic Fest psychological drama Pelican Blood, a horse trainer travels from Germany to Bulgaria to adopt a 5-year-old girl. At first, Raya (Katerina Lipovska) seems content to live with her adoptive mother Wiebke (Nina Hoss) and gets along well with her new sister Nicotine (Adelia-Constance Ocleppo). But Raya, who was orphaned under terrible circumstances, soon begins to act out violently. When Raya is diagnosed with reactive attachment disorder, Wiebke vows to fight for Raya's love and devotion. But the cost is much higher than Wiebke expects. Katrin Gebbe previously directed Nothing Bad Can Happen and contributed the segment A Nocturnal Breath to the Tim League-produced horror anthology The Field Guide to Evil.
